OEM windshields come with the rain sensor pad infused into the glass. The only aftermarket windshields that offer this same design is PPG. If you have some aftermarket windshield without the pad infused, that is where those stick on pads come into play. Many people here say it does not work and I started believing the same because my w210 came with a cheap aftermarket windshield with a stick on pad and the rain sensor didn't work. I took it to a glass shop and they put in a new stick on pad for $60 and reattached the sensor and somehow now it works.
